Frequently Asked Questions
Bookings
- Q Do I need to book?
- A Yes! It is the only way in which we can ensure you get to play.
- Q How far in advance should I book?
- A As far in advance as possible please! Whilst we will always try to help at 'short notice' - the more time you can give us, the greater the chance of getting that perfect paintball party exactly when and where you want it!
- Q How many Players do I need?
- A For a weekend, any amount is normally fine. You will be mixed in with other groups that are also booked at the site so there will be plenty of people to shoot at! Midweek days are also fine but the sites will usually require a minimum group size of 10 to 20 players to maximise the action!
- Q Can I play with just my own group?
- A You would need to have enough players to fill your own game zone, normally about 30 or more.
- Q How can I book?
- A Either by booking online or by calling 0844 745 5000. You will need to pay a non-refundable deposit per person to secure your places so it is a good idea to collect this money from your group in advance.
- Q How can I pay my deposit?
- A Either via our secure online booking service or over the telephone (0844 745 5000). We accept credit or debit card. We do accept cheques but you would need to call us on 0844 745 5000 to arrange this.
- Q How can I organise a group booking?
- A Our quotes are interactive – so you can invite your group members through the quote and then they can book and pay separately as and when they are ready. They can also view all the details of the quote – saves the organiser a lot of work. You can add to your group up to the maximum at any time up to 14 days before the event date.

Times
- Q What time do the sessions run?
- A This does vary from site to site. The actual times will be printed on your booking confirmation forms. It is advised that you arrive around twenty minutes prior to this start time.
- Q What happens if I arrive late?
- A Please endeavour to let us know if you are running late and the site will do their best to accommodate you. There is no guarantee that you will be able to play if you are late.
Lunch
- Q What does lunch include?
- A A light lunch is provided on a full day session only and it varies from site to site. A typical example would be a sandwich or a hot dog.
- Q Can I bring alcohol?
- A No. No-one is allowed to play under the influence of alcohol.
- Q Do you cater for vegetarians?
- A Yes. One or two vegetarians in your group can be catered for on the day. If there will be large amount of vegetarians in your party, please let us know when you make your booking.
- Q Im just booking for a morning or afternoon, will I get lunch?
- A No. A light lunch is only available on a full day session. You are welcome to bring snacks to eat between the games and most sites will be able to sell you a chocolate bar or similar also.
Kids Paintball
- Q What is the minimum age to play?
- A The minimum age for most sites is twelve years old but for some sites it can be as high as eighteen. Any players under sixteen will need to bring a completed parental consent form with them which are supplied with your booking confirmation or can be downloaded here.
Paintballs
- Q Can I bring my own paintballs?
- A No. Only paintballs purchased at the site, or purchased in advance at a discount from Go Ballistic can be used.
- Q Can we buy extra paintballs on the day?
- A Yes! The price per hundred does vary from site to site. Expect to pay around £6 to £8 per hundred on average.
Equipment
- Q Can I bring my own equipment?
- A Players must use the paintballs and paintball markers provided on the day by the site. Most sites will allow you to use your own mask or camouflage clothing if they are adequate.
- Q Will I need to pay for anything extra on the day?
- A The game fees include all the equipment needed with the exception of paintballs. These can be bought at the site.
- Q What should I wear?
- A Sensible outdoor shoes and a couple of layers of old clothes. Overalls are provided but please bare in mind that it could be muddy!
Facilities
- Q Are showers available?
- A No.
- Q Is there anywhere to leave valuables?
- A No. Items are left at your own risk. We would recommend keeping things out of sight in a locked car.
Location
Littlehampton paintball is situated just off the A259 coast road at Climping near Littlehampton, West Sussex which makes it the ideal paintball site for players on this part of the Sussex coastline. Portsmouth, Brighton, Worthing and Bognor Regis are all with easy striking distance of the site.
Full travel details provided on booking.

Directions
Maps and directions used on our website are for guide purposes only. Please use the directions supplied with your booking confirmation when making travel arrangements.
From the West by Car
After leaving Bognor Regis, drive past the junction for Yapton/Middleton for two miles. As you go past the sign for Climping we are the first road on your right.At the first traffic island, directly opposite the Oystercatcher pub, follow the concrete road for about one mile and you'll find us.
From the East by Car
After leaving Littlehampton, drive for one mile to reach a roundabout for Arundel/Bognor Regis. Continue on the A259 for another mile, going past the farm shop and Climping Street on your left.Take the next turning on your left, directly opposite the Oystercatcher pub. Follow the concrete road for about one mile and you'll find us.
From The North by Car
After leaving Arundel, take the Ford/Climping Road off the A27 roundabout. Follow this road for two miles and go over the level crossing,past the prison and church. You'll reach a roundabout on the A259 for Littlehampton/Bognor Regis.Turn right, continue for another mile, go past the farm shop & Climping Street on your left and take the next turning on your left, directly opposite the Oystercatcher pub.Follow the concrete road for about one mile and you'll find us.
